§ 10. Definitions. As used in this Act:
“Agreement” means a public private agreement.
“Contractor” means a person that has been selected to enter or has entered into a public private agreement with the Department on behalf of the State for the development, financing, construction, management, or operation of the Illiana Expressway pursuant to this Act.
“Department” means the Illinois Department of Transportation.
“Illiana Expressway” means the fully access-controlled interstate highway connecting Interstate Highway 55 in northeastern Illinois to Interstate Highway 65 in northwestern Indiana, which may be operated as a toll or non-toll facility.
“Metropolitan planning organization” means a metropolitan planning organization designated under 23 U.S.C. Section 134.
“Offeror” means a person that responds to a request for proposals under this Act.
“Person” means any individual, firm, association, joint venture, partnership, estate, trust, syndicate, fiduciary, corporation, or any other legal entity, group, or combination thereof.
“Public private agreement” means an agreement or contract between the Department on behalf of the State and all schedules, exhibits, and attachments thereto, entered into pursuant to a competitive request for proposals process governed by the Illinois Procurement Code and rules adopted under that Code and this Act, for the development, financing, construction, management, or operation of the Illiana Expressway pursuant to this Act.
“Revenues” means all revenues including but not limited to income; user fees; earnings; interest; lease payments; allocations; moneys from the federal government, the State, and units of local government, including but not limited to federal, State, and local appropriations, grants, loans, lines of credit, and credit guarantees; bond proceeds; equity investments; service payments; or other receipts arising out of or in connection with the financing, development, construction, management, or operation of the Illiana Expressway.
“State” means the State of Illinois.
“Secretary” means the Secretary of the Illinois Department of Transportation.
“Unit of local government” has the meaning ascribed to that term in Article VII, Section 1 of the Constitution of the State of Illinois, and, for purposes of this Act, includes school districts.
“User fees” means the tolls, rates, fees, or other charges imposed by the State or the contractor for use of all or part of the Illiana Expressway.
